Nurse Manager-Substance Abuse and Detox Facility

Job Title: Nursing Manager (Substance Use Disorder Services) Location: Baltimore, Maryland Schedule: Full-Time, Day Shift (On-Call Availability Required) Compensation: Salary based on experience SIGN ON BONUS: $5,000 Position Overview: We are seeking an experienced and compassionate Nursing Manager to oversee clinical nursing operations within our substance use disorder (SUD) programs, including detoxification and residential treatment services. This leadership role is responsible for ensuring high-quality patient care, regulatory compliance, and effective team management in a fast-paced, mission-driven environment. Key Responsibilities: Provide leadership and oversight to nursing staff across detox and residential programs Ensure delivery of safe, effective, and patient-centered care Supervise, train, and mentor nursing team members, including performance management Coordinate staffing schedules and ensure appropriate coverage, including on-call support Collaborate with medical providers, therapists, and leadership to support treatment planning and patient outcomes Maintain compliance with all federal, state, and accreditation standards Monitor and improve clinical workflows, documentation, and quality assurance processes Participate in hiring, onboarding, and ongoing staff development Respond to clinical issues and emergencies as needed Qualifications: Active Registered Nurse (RN) license in the state of Maryland (or eligible for endorsement) Minimum of 3–5 years of nursing experience, with at least 1–2 years in a leadership or management role Direct experience in substance use disorder treatment, including detox and residential settings required Strong leadership, communication, and organizational skills Knowledge of regulatory requirements and best practices in behavioral health/SUD treatment Ability to work full-time day shift with flexibility for on-call responsibilities Preferred Qualifications: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) or higher Prior experience in a supervisory or program management role within behavioral health Experience with electronic medical records (EMR) systems Benefits: Medical, dental, and vision insurance Paid time off (PTO) 401(k) with company match Supportive and collaborative work environment Opportunity for growth and advancement

Acts is currently seeking qualified candidates for the role of Registered Nurse (RN) Supervisor in our skilled nursing neighborhood. In this role, you will supervise all aspects of direct and indirect nursing care to the residents in our skilled nursing neighborhood. Prepares, reviews, and coordinates nursing assignments and work schedules to assure attendance and makes arrangements for replacements as necessary. Assists the Director of Nursing in the job performance evaluation of nursing personnel. Requirements The ideal candidate will meet the following requirements: Current State license as Registered Nurse (RN) Minimum of two years related nursing experience with increasing supervisory responsibilities Current or eligible for certification in CPR Advanced knowledge of nursing principles and physical assessment skills Team members are eligible for a generous benefit package including health benefits (medical, prescription, dental and vision), flexible spending accounts, life insurance, disability programs, 401(k) plan (with 4% company match after one year of employment), paid time off and holidays, and much more!
